Yoplait SKYR has been announced as a Premium Partner of the Hiscox Padel Irish Open 2026.
The tournament, part of the Cupra FIP Tour, the International Padel Federation’s global circuit, returns to Dublin from July 14th to 19th at Star Padel, St Mary’s College Rugby Club in Templeogue.
The partnership will see Yoplait SKYR, the high-protein Icelandic-style yoghurt brand, feature prominently throughout the event, including in the Hiscox Village fan zone, where spectators will have access to food, entertainment, family activities, and brand activations alongside the on-court action.
Padel has enjoyed rapid growth in Ireland in recent years, with an estimated 60,000 people now playing the sport nationwide. The Hiscox Padel Irish Open has quickly become the leading competitive showcase for the sport on the island, combining international ranking points with a growing festival-style fan experience.
The 2026 edition has also been awarded a higher ranking on the Cupra FIP Tour than last year’s inaugural event, helping to attract a stronger field of international and Irish athletes. Prequalification rounds begin on July 15th, with the main spectator days running from Wednesday, July 15th, through to the Grand Final on Sunday, July 19th.

As a Premium Partner, Yoplait SKYR will use the event to connect with an active, family-focused audience. Its activation will include product sampling and consumer engagement across the weekend, reinforcing the brand’s positioning around protein, wellness and everyday performance.
